The team from Alt Empordà will play its match against Granollers this Saturday at 4 PM, corresponding to the penultimate round of the competition. Despite two recent away victories that have lifted them out of the direct relegation zone, their twelfth position is still threatened by the possibility of uncompensated relegations that could affect lower divisions.
This situation creates a domino effect that keeps several teams on alert. The permanence of Olot in Segunda Federación is key, as if they fail to secure survival in their Sunday match against Valencia B, they could drag down teams from lower categories. Olot needs a victory to ensure their continuity; otherwise, they would depend on the results of other teams like Castellón and Ibiza.
The complexity of the promotion and relegation system means that the fall of a Catalan team from higher categories can cause an imbalance in the number of teams per division. The promotion of Manresa has already compensated for the relegation of Atlètic Lleida from Segunda Federación. However, if another Catalan team were to drop from Segunda, it would be necessary for one of the four Catalan teams playing in the Tercera play-off to achieve promotion to avoid further uncompensated relegations.
Therefore, Olot's salvation would allow the first teams saved in each category to breathe easier, provided there are no administrative relegations, a frequent occurrence in recent years. Figueres, for its part, wants to avoid depending on third parties and will seek victory against Granollers to consolidate its position and face the next matchday with less pressure, which includes a difficult visit to the field of Lloret, a team fighting for direct promotion.
